Start With Regulation and Account Security
Regulation is the foundation of a trustworthy casino. A licensed operator should clearly display its company information, regulatory authority, licence details, and dispute-resolution process. These signals do not guarantee a winning experience, but they indicate that the platform operates under defined standards.
Security should be equally visible. Look for encrypted connections, secure login procedures, and sensible identity verification. Know Your Customer checks can feel inconvenient, yet they help prevent fraud, underage access, and the misuse of financial accounts. A reputable casino will explain why documents are requested and how personal data is handled.
Essential checks before registration
- Confirm that the operator names a recognised licensing authority.
- Read the privacy policy and terms before opening an account.
- Check whether two-factor authentication or login alerts are available.
- Verify the minimum age requirement for your jurisdiction.
- Review the stated withdrawal and verification procedures.
Compare Games, Software, and Fairness
Game variety is useful only when it matches your preferences and budget. A strong casino normally offers a balanced selection of slots, table games, live-dealer rooms, and sometimes sports or virtual products. More important than the size of the lobby is the quality of the software providers and the clarity of each game’s rules.
Slots should display volatility, paylines, and return-to-player information where applicable. Table games need clear betting limits, while live casino titles should identify the studio, streaming format, and available side bets. Independent testing and published random-number-generator standards provide additional reassurance that outcomes are not being manipulated.
| Evaluation area | What to examine | Why it matters |
|---|---|---|
| Game library | Providers, categories, mobile performance | Shows whether the platform serves different playing styles |
| Fairness | RTP information, testing statements, game rules | Helps players understand expected long-term results |
| Banking | Supported methods, fees, processing times | Reduces uncertainty when depositing or withdrawing |
| Support | Live chat, email, response quality | Reveals how problems are handled |
Read the Promotion Beyond the Headline
Bonuses can add value, but their real conditions are often found beneath the headline figure. A welcome offer may include a deposit requirement, wagering multiplier, maximum qualifying amount, game restrictions, expiry period, and maximum cash-out rule. Each condition changes the practical value of the promotion.
Consider a bonus as a contract rather than free money. If a casino advertises a percentage match, calculate the eligible deposit and the amount that must be wagered. Also check whether bonus funds are locked until playthrough is completed. Players who prefer simple budgeting may find a lower promotional offer with clearer terms more useful than an aggressive package with complex restrictions.
Make Banking and Mobile Use Part of the Review
Payment options should suit your location and preferred currency. Cards, bank transfers, electronic wallets, and selected alternative methods may have different limits and processing times. Deposits are frequently instant, while withdrawals can require additional verification and manual approval. Always review fees before confirming a transaction.
Mobile usability deserves a practical test. A responsive website should load quickly, preserve navigation on smaller screens, and make payment and account controls easy to reach. An official application can be convenient, but players should download it only from a verified source. Avoid unofficial files or links that request unnecessary permissions.
Responsible Play Is a Quality Indicator
A serious operator makes safer gambling tools easy to find. Useful options include deposit limits, time reminders, cooling-off periods, self-exclusion, reality checks, and access to transaction history. These controls should work without forcing a player to contact support for every adjustment.
Set a budget before playing and treat every wager as entertainment spending. Never use borrowed money, chase losses, or increase stakes to recover an unsuccessful session. If gambling begins to affect finances, work, sleep, or relationships, stop playing and contact an appropriate support service.
